Medibank has revealed its plan to distribute an additional $160 million to customers this year as part of its give-back initiative. This cash-back program will offer payments ranging from $50 to $255, depending on the type of policy held by the customers. Eligible extras-only policyholders can expect around $50, while those with hospital and extras policies might receive about $130 on average.
Eligible customers will be contacted with details regarding their cash back, which will be automatically deposited into their bank accounts by the end of September. To qualify for this payment, Medibank customers must have been active holders of a hospital or extras policy as of June 30.
This initiative is being funded through permanent savings in net claims accumulated during the COVID-19 pandemic, resulting in a $160 million reduction in the reserve balance. Chief Customer Officer Milosh Milisavljevic stated that Medibank is committed to ensuring that it does not profit from the pandemic while customer claims were significantly impacted.
Despite the easing of COVID-19 restrictions over the last couple of years, claims have remained lower than expected. This has prompted Medibank to return more funds to customers. The intent behind this financial assistance is to ease pressures on household budgets amid rising living costs.
The financial support from Medibank has been substantial since the onset of the pandemic, with the insurer having returned a record $1.62 billion to its customers over this period. Previous years saw returns of $443 million in 2022, $408 million in 2023, and $305 million in 2024.
